Blockchain Art Sales

Blockchain technology has revolutionized the art world by providing a decentralized and transparent platform for art sales. As a crypto art dealer, leveraging blockchain technology can enhance the authenticity and provenance of the artworks you sell. Blockchain ensures that each piece of art is unique, verifiable, and tamper-proof. This transparency builds trust with buyers and can significantly increase the value of the art. Utilize blockchain explorers to showcase the history and ownership of each piece, making your listings more attractive to potential buyers.

Smart Contracts for NFTs

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. They play a crucial role in NFT transactions by automating the transfer of ownership and ensuring that all parties adhere to the agreed terms. As an NFT seller, understanding how to create and deploy smart contracts can give you a competitive edge. Smart contracts can automate royalty payments, ensuring that artists receive a percentage of sales each time their work is resold. This feature is particularly appealing to artists and can make your platform more attractive to high-quality creators.

How to Price NFTs

Pricing NFTs can be challenging due to the subjective nature of art and the volatility of the crypto market. However, several strategies can help you determine a fair and competitive price. Consider factors such as the artist's reputation, the uniqueness and rarity of the piece, and recent sales of similar works. Additionally, take into account the current market demand and trends. Pricing strategies can include fixed pricing, auctions, or a combination of both. Regularly reviewing and adjusting your pricing strategy based on market feedback and sales performance is crucial for long-term success.

How can I ensure the authenticity of an NFT before purchasing?

To verify an NFT's authenticity, check its metadata and transaction history on the blockchain using tools like Etherscan or the marketplace's verification system. Additionally, look for a blue checkmark or verified badge on the seller's profile, indicating that the marketplace has confirmed their identity.

What are the typical fees associated with buying and selling NFTs?

NFT marketplaces charge various fees, including gas fees (for blockchain transactions), listing fees, and sales commissions. For instance, OpenSea charges a 2.5% commission on sales, while gas fees can range from $10 to over $100, depending on network congestion. Be sure to factor these costs into your buying or selling strategy.

What are the most common blockchain standards for NFTs?

The most popular blockchain standards for NFTs are ERC-721 and ERC-1155 on the Ethereum network. ERC-721 is the original NFT standard, allowing for the creation of unique, non-fungible tokens. ERC-1155, on the other hand, enables the creation of both fungible and non-fungible tokens within a single contract, providing greater flexibility and efficiency for developers.

How do NFT smart contracts work, and what are their key components?

NFT smart contracts are self-executing agreements that govern the creation, ownership, and transfer of NFTs. Key components include token metadata (such as name, description, and image), ownership details, and transfer functions. Smart contracts also define any additional features or utilities, such as royalties, staking rewards, or access rights.

What is the role of metadata in NFTs, and how is it stored?

Metadata is crucial for NFTs, as it contains essential information about the token, such as its name, description, and image. Metadata can be stored directly on the blockchain (on-chain) or hosted externally (off-chain) and linked to the NFT via a URL. On-chain storage provides greater decentralization and permanence, while off-chain storage offers more flexibility and lower costs.

What are the environmental concerns surrounding NFTs, and how are they being addressed?

NFTs have faced criticism for their environmental impact, particularly due to the energy-intensive proof-of-work (PoW) consensus mechanism used by some blockchains. To address these concerns, many NFT projects are transitioning to more eco-friendly alternatives, such as proof-of-stake (PoS) blockchains or layer-2 solutions. For example, Ethereum's upcoming transition to PoS is expected to reduce its energy consumption by up to 99%. Additionally, some NFT marketplaces and projects are implementing carbon offset initiatives or donating a portion of their proceeds to environmental causes.
